Welcome aboard! One thing you'll touch early is undo/redo in Sketchloom, our diagram editor. Every edit goes through the command bus, so undo is just replaying inverse commands — don't mutate canvas state directly or you'll break the history stack. The local dev build talks to the history-sync service in staging, and you'll need credentials for that before anything works. Drop the following key into your dev config.

gateway credential: kto3_qfe

Management Meeting Minutes — Korvale Franchise Agreement

Present: Mira, Dags, Petter. Quick recap for finance: the Korvale franchise terms are mostly settled — five-year term, royalty at 4.5%, marketing levy deferred for year one. Legal still chasing the territory clause for the Nordby corridor. Dags will circulate cost models by Friday. One sensitive point came up, recorded separately just below.

internal memo for fajog-yagaf: Gross margin on Ulaael came in at 20 percent against a plan of 10 percent. Only 9 of the 80 pilot accounts renewed Ulaael, so a churn review is set for July 1.

Hi Dorve,

For the eng sync: the migration of nightly cron jobs onto the Wrenvale workflow engine is about 80% done. Remaining holdouts are the ledger rollup and the stale-session sweep, both blocked on retry-semantics questions. Schedules are now declared in `flows/` and validated at merge time. Workflow bundles must be signed before the engine will schedule them, and the deploy key for that signing step is below.

signing key of bagap-yawep = bky13_TbfT6ZMUoGJo2

### Payment Retries — Idempotency Keys

Plugin authors integrating with the Tollbridge payment core must attach a unique idempotency key to every charge attempt. On retry, reuse the original key exactly; the core will return the stored result rather than charging twice. Keys expire after 72 hours, so do not retry beyond that window. Stored keys and their outcomes can be audited in the ledger database via the connection string below.

replica DSN, kajep-yahag: mssql://praok_svc:iF@db-8d68.plorvaio.local:5432/eliion